Can you join the Enclave in Fallout 76?

Absolutely, you can join the Enclave in Fallout 76! It's one of the factions you can align with in the game. To do this, you'll have to complete a series of quests that start at the Abandoned Waste Dump in the Mire. These quests will eventually lead you to the Whitespring Bunker, where you'll officially become a part of the Enclave. It's a fun storyline that gives you access to some cool gear and the ability to launch nukes!
